One way to elevate your kitchen with gray is to use it as the primary color scheme. A monochromatic gray kitchen can be both sleek and sophisticated, creating a cohesive and visually appealing space. You can choose to paint your walls and cabinets in different shades of gray, or opt for gray countertops and backsplashes to add depth and dimension to the room. To prevent the space from feeling too dull or monotonous, you can add pops of color with decorative accents like colorful kitchen appliances or vibrant artwork.

Another way to incorporate gray into your kitchen design is by using it as an accent color. If you prefer a more neutral color palette, you can choose to have white or light-colored cabinets and countertops, and add touches of gray with accessories like bar stools, pendant lights, or kitchen hardware. This allows you to experiment with different shades of gray without overwhelming the space, and gives you the flexibility to change up the look easily in the future.
For those who want to make a bold statement with their kitchen design, dark shades of gray can create a dramatic and luxurious atmosphere. Dark gray cabinets paired with gold or brass hardware can add a touch of glamour to the space, while a dark gray island can serve as a focal point in an otherwise neutral kitchen. To balance out the darkness, you can incorporate lighter elements like white marble countertops or light wood flooring to create a sense of contrast and balance.
In addition to cabinets and countertops, you can also use gray in other elements of your kitchen design. Gray tile backsplashes can add texture and interest to the space, while gray flooring can create a modern and cohesive look throughout the room. You can also consider incorporating gray in your kitchen furniture, such as gray upholstered bar stools or dining chairs, to tie the design together and create a cohesive look.

One of the first things to consider when designing a modern kitchen is the color scheme. While white kitchens have been a popular choice for many years, incorporating shades of gray can add a sense of sophistication and luxury to the space. Gray is a versatile color that can be easily paired with other colors such as black, white, or even pops of bright colors for a more dynamic look.
To achieve a stylish and modern look in your kitchen, consider using a mix of materials such as stainless steel, glass, and wood. These materials not only add visual interest to the space but also help create a sleek and polished look. For example, you can opt for stainless steel appliances and fixtures, glass countertops, and wood cabinets to create a balanced and harmonious design.
In addition to the materials used, the layout of the kitchen also plays a crucial role in achieving modern elegance. Consider incorporating a kitchen island or a breakfast bar for added functionality and style. These features not only provide additional counter space for meal prep but also create a central focal point in the room. You can also consider adding a statement light fixture above the island or bar to add a touch of glamour to the space.
Another key element in modern kitchen design is storage. To maintain a clean and clutter-free look, consider integrating hidden storage solutions such as pull-out cabinets, pantry organizers, and built-in appliances. These sleek storage options not only help maximize space but also keep the kitchen looking organized and streamlined.
When it comes to choosing kitchen furniture and accessories, opt for pieces that are both stylish and functional. Consider investing in furniture with clean lines and minimalistic designs to create a contemporary look. You can also add pops of color through accessories such as rugs, curtains, and artwork to add warmth and personality to the space.
In terms of lighting, consider incorporating a mix of natural and artificial light to create a bright and welcoming atmosphere in the kitchen. Install large windows to allow natural light to flood the space during the day, and add recessed lighting, pendant lights, or track lighting for added illumination in the evenings.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ood and ambiance in the kitchen, so be sure to choose fixtures that complement the overall design of the space.
